What is the Telc B1 Language Test?
The Telc B1 Language Test is created to assess language abilities throughout 4 essential areas: reading, writing, listening, and speaking. It aligns with the Common European Framework of Reference for Languages (CEFR) and certifies that a candidate has the capability to interact successfully in everyday scenarios.
- Target Group: Adults and young people who need to demonstrate their intermediate German skills for individual, academic, or professional purposes.
- Certification: The exam results in a certification that is acknowledged across Europe.
Test Structure
The Telc B1 test consists of 4 sections, each examining a various element of language proficiency. Below is a detailed table of the test structure.
Area
Duration
Description
Points Available
Checking out
30 minutes
Understanding of composed texts, consisting of posts and e-mails.
25
Listening
20 minutes
Comprehending spoken language through conversations and announcements.
25
Composing
30 minutes
Composing a brief text, such as a letter or e-mail, on a given topic.
25
Speaking
15 minutes
Interactive speaking tasks, including a discussion and a monologue.
25
Overall Duration of the Test
The whole test lasts approximately 1 hour and 35 minutes. Prospects ought to get ready for a mix of tasks that need both individual abilities and interactive language usage.

Advantages of Taking the Telc B1 Exam
Getting a Telc B1 certificate provides numerous advantages:
- Recognition: The certificate is commonly accepted by universities, employers, and federal government bodies in German-speaking nations.
- Profession Opportunities: Many companies need proof of language efficiency for job applications, making the Telc B1 accreditation a valuable asset.
- Higher Education: The certificate can serve as a prerequisite for enrolling in specific academic programs in Germany or other German-speaking countries.
- Personal Growth: Achieving a language efficiency certificate improves confidence and encourages additional language knowing.
